<h3>What is cylinder?</h3>
A cylinder is a three-dimensional shape consisting of two parallel circular bases, joined by a curved surface. The center of the circular bases overlaps each other to form a right cylinder.

(2,1), (-2,-1)
slope(m) = (-1-1) / (-2 - 2) = -2/-4 = 1/2
parallel lines will have the same slope
y = mx + b
slope(m) = 1/2
(-4,8)...x = -4 and y = 8
now sub and find b, the y int
8 = 1/2(-4) + b
8 = -2 + b
8 + 2 = b
10 = b
so ur equation is : y = 1/2x + 10 <==
